Headingley Station is equipped with all the essential amenities catering to a variety of travelers. While there isn't a traditional ticket office, rest assured that ticket machines are available for purchasing and collecting tickets bought online. They are accessible for all, ensuring ease of use. For those embracing the digital age, smartcards can be both issued and validated here. Although staff assistance isn't available at the station, there's always help just a call away. CCTV cameras provide security, while departure screens and announcements keep you informed.
If accessibility is a concern, you'll be pleased to know that Headingley Station is a Category A station, with step-free access throughout. Lifts and subways facilitate easy movement across the platforms. However, amenities such as toilets, waiting rooms, and refreshment options are not present, so it's best to plan accordingly. With a modest car park offering some free spaces, you won't have to worry about parking charges while you catch your train.
Once you've arrived at Headingley, a host of onward travel options are available to help you reach your final destination. Bus services can be accessed conveniently with a stop located close to the station, and for detailed information, Busline can be reached at 0871 200 2233. If you're opting for taxis, you can pre-book through their Cab4you service. Cyclists will be glad to know that while bicycle hire isn't available at the station, there is limited bicycle storage within the car park.

Bicester Village station is equipped with a range of facilities tailored to enhance your travel experience. The ticket office operates extensive hours—from as early as 5:30 AM to 9:00 PM on weekdays—making it easy to obtain or collect your tickets. Accessible ticket machines and induction loops are also in place to assist passengers with disabilities.
While the station boasts comprehensive amenities such as step-free access to all platforms, CCTV security, and waiting rooms open until late, it notably lacks some facilities like a 1st Class Lounge and a currency exchange. You can enjoy refreshment facilities on-site, ensuring you're well-fueled, whether for an all-day shopping spree or a simple commute.
Regarding onward travel, options abound at Bicester Village station. The Bicester Village Shuttle Bus offers a practical service by connecting between Bicester Village station and Bicester North every 15 minutes. This makes catching regional train services or exploring local areas hassle-free. The Station Approach Road also acts as the assembly point for any rail replacement services, aiding those in the event of unexpected travel disruptions.
